// JavaScript Document
function formvalid(){
	frm = document.form1 ;	
	
	if(checkspace(frm.email, "Enter Your Email")){return false;}
	if (frm.email.value.substr(frm.email.value.indexOf('@')).indexOf('.') < 2){
			alert("Please Enter a Valid E-Mail Address");
			frm.email.focus();
			return false;
		}
	if(checkspace(frm.remail, "Enter Your Email")){return false;}
	if(frm.email.value != frm.remail.value){
		alert("Retype Email is wrong")	;
		frm.remail.focus();
		return false;
	}
	if(checkspace(frm.pwd, "Enter Password")){return false;}
	if(CheckLength(frm.pwd,"your password length must be 6 characters")){return false;}
	if(checkspace(frm.fname, "Enter First name")){return false;}
	if(checkspace(frm.lname, "Enter Last name")){return false;}
	//if(checkspace(frm.mname, "Enter Middle name")){return false;}
//	if(checkspace(frm.email2, "Enter Email")){return false;}
	//if(checkspace(frm.fax, "Enter Fax Number")){return false;}
//	if(checkspace(frm.hph, "Enter Home Phone")){return false;}
	if(checkspace(frm.street, "Enter street")){return false;}
	if(checkspace(frm.appt, "Enter Appartment")){return false;}
	if(checkspace(frm.city, "Enter City")){return false;}
	if(checkspace(frm.provinence, "Enter Provinence")){return false;}
	if(checkspace(frm.pcode, "Enter Pin/zip code")){return false;}
	if(CheckList(frm.ref , "Enter How did you reach us?")){return false ;}
	//if(CheckList(frm.dd , "Enter Date")){return false ;}
//	if(CheckList(frm.mm , "Enter Month")){return false ;}
//	if(CheckList(frm.yy , "Enter Year")){return false ;}
	//if(CheckList(frm.mat , "Enter Matrial Status")){return false ;}
//	if(CheckList(frm.depend, "Number of dependents should not be empty")){return false;}
	if(checkspace(frm.ins, "Enter Social Insurence Number")){return false;}
	if(CheckList(frm.residence , "Enter Residence")){return false ;}
	if(checkspace(frm.mholder, "Enter Landlord/Motgage Holder")){return false;}
	if(checkspace(frm.amount, "Enter Rent/Mortgage Monthly Amount")){return false;}

}
function onk(){
 	 document.form1.email2.value  =	document.form1.email.value ;
	
}

function checkspace(Txtobj,msg)
{

  if(Txtobj.value != "" )

	{		
			field=Txtobj.value;
			var temp = field;
			var obj = /^(\s*)([\W\w]*)(\b\s*$)/;
			if (obj.test(temp)) { temp = temp.replace(obj, '$2'); }
			var obj = / +/g;
			temp = temp.replace(obj, " ");
			if (temp == " ") { temp = ""; }
			Txtobj.value=temp;
			Txtobj.focus();
            //alert(topsearch.value)
}


 if(Txtobj.value == "" )
 {
 alert(msg);
 Txtobj.focus();
 return true;
 }
 
 return false;
 
 }
 
 
 function CheckValue(TxtBox,Msg)
{
	if(TxtBox.value=='')
	{
		alert(Msg);
		TxtBox.focus();
		return true;
	}
	return false;
}
function CheckLength(TxtBox,Msg)
{ 
  	if(TxtBox.value.length<6||TxtBox.value.length>20)
  	{
   	alert(Msg);
   	TxtBox.focus();
   	return true;
   	}
	 return false;
}
function CheckList(Obj,Msg){

		if(Obj.selectedIndex == 0){
			alert(Msg);
			Obj.focus();
			return true;
		}

	}